Mechanical Lead (m/f/d) Data Center Construction Your Tasks PORR is expanding its data center activities and is seeking a Mechanical Lead to manage mechanical site delivery on a large data center construction project. The role covers mechanical installation, plant coordination, subcontractor management, technical interfaces, quality control, testing support, and commissioning readiness. Leadership of mechanical works on site, including cooling systems, chilled water, pipework, ventilation, CRAH/CRAC units, plant rooms, pumps, valves, supports, insulation, and fire protection interfaces Coordination of mechanical subcontractors and verification of compliance with current drawings, specifications, and approved method statements Review of mechanical drawings, technical submissions, procurement status, and installation details Coordination of plant access, lifting routes, installation sequence, maintenance zones, and testing areas Coordination of mechanical interfaces with electrical, CSA, BMS, controls, fire protection, and commissioning teams Tracking of long-lead equipment, testing readiness, flushing, pressure testing, balancing, and pre-commissioning status Coordination of inspections with QA/QC and completion of test records and handover documents Safe control of mechanical works, including lifting, pressure testing, hot works, and permit requirements
Your Profile Degree in mechanical engineering or comparable mechanical qualification Minimum 8 years' mechanical construction experience on large projects Experience in data center, mission-critical, industrial, energy, or high-tech projects preferred Strong knowledge of cooling systems, chilled water, ventilation, plant installation, pipework, valves, supports, testing, and commissioning interfaces Good understanding of maintainability, access, water quality, leak prevention, and BMS/controls interfaces Experience managing mechanical subcontractors and vendor packages Relevant mechanical qualifications or construction licences desirable Fluency in English; German or Polish language skills advantageous
